In this podcast episode, we're joined by world-renowned Scottish mountain biker and trials rider Danny MacAskill for his most in-depth interview yet. We sit down with Danny at his home in Scotland to dive deep into his incredible journey, from riding the streets of Dunvegan as a kid to becoming an international sensation.
Discover the real story behind his viral breakout video, Inspired Bicycles, and how a chance encounter with a BMX rider changed everything. Danny opens up about the creative process behind his viral edits, managing fame, and his thoughts on retirement.
He also shares insights into risk and injury, and hints at exciting future projects. If you're a fan of extreme sports, biking, or just love a good success story, this conversation is a must-watch!
